Equity Calculation Agent
£20.00 - £25.00 Per Hour
City Of London

This pre-eminent investment bank as one of the world's leading wealth management, capital markets and advisory companies, with offices in 40 countries and territories requires the services of an experienced results and standards driven Equity Calculation Agent.

The primary objective of this role is to help support Exotic Equity Derivative Trading team in London and assist them with all the Operational queries and bookings that are required in order to ensure client service excellence and satisfaction. The Middle Office is a centralised contact point for desk, clients, settlements and documentation areas to go to for resolution of operational issues that may arise. Part of the function will include working with the team, traders and technology to implement better controls and processes on many of the Equity Derivative OTC (Exotic Structures, Options, swaps) and Securitised products (e.g. Warrants, Certificates).

KEY RESPONSIBILITIES :

The team will cover the following areas either directly or indirectly.

*Reviewing term-sheets to understand the pay off profiles/formulae of all Equity-linked EMTN / exotic trades.
*Calculating periodic coupon and redemption pay-offs, validating against RAM bookings.
*Announcing coupon / redemption details to all parties involved, including external paying agents and clearing house.
*Option Expiry on equity structured baskets - calculation of final payment and checks to confirm settlement
*Ensuring that all the underlying economics of new trades are accurately reflected in the trading systems and trade expiries are correctly reflected in the RAM booking.
*To understand market events such as trigger/discretionary calls, barrier options (Knock in/out), best/worst-offs etc
*Liaising with Issuers, Clearing houses, IPAs, traders and marketers to resolve any pending issues/queries
*FSA Transaction reporting.
*Daily reporting of all equity-linked exceptions to the FSA via website.
*Liaising with front and middle office to resolve these exceptions.

The ideal candidate for this role will need experience in supporting an ELT Trading desk and clients operationally in a previous role. You will also need an understanding of controls and implementation. You will also need a good understanding of the core concepts underlying derivatives valuations, the key factors affecting derivatives valuations and Elementary statistics.
